What's the fastest growing sport in the G.T.A?...CRICKET!
On Tuesday, June 6th approximately 140 elementary students from gr. 5 to 8 participated in DECA's first post pandemic DECA Cricket Tournament at the Whitby Indoor Dome.
Enthusiastic students from St. Isaac Jogues, St. John Bosco, St. Monica, St. Bernadette, St. Andre Bessette, St. Mark, Msgr. Philip Coffey, St. Catherine of Siena, Father Fenelon, St. Francis de Sales, played 4 matches each and had a chance to bowl and bat and show their Cricket skills.
